Conclusion & Summary
The analysis establishes certain clear benefits from the device including in cases of upgrade and technology evaluations. This opens possibility of planning more smooth transitions or stepwise approach to future migrations or updates. The usage of mainstream emulators could save time for the industrial automation community and allow more focus on application details. This opens scope for further collaboration with mainstream communication technology communities/organizations.
Next Steps are planned to focus on:
1) Include more use cases and perform validations to assess adaptability for various scenarios.
2) Seamless integration of multiple communication stacks and applying model driven development techniques for reduced time and effort.
3) Experiments need to be scaled up using profiles of Substation, Power Plant DCS and Microgrid and also develop insight into few intra plant scenarios.
The Experimentation Setup

A Configurator PC, running Scenario Definition Toolkit and able to download and configure the device.

A Raspberry Pi Running Raspian OS. Mininet hosted on the Operating System with the Topology loaded from the configurator tool.
Custom communication stacks running/hosted on the Mininet Nodes thereby replicating the domain specific environment and devices.
The Flow Capture performed using inbuilt Wireshark thereby able to categorize the traffic.

Various scenarios analyzed from HMI upgrades, technology upgrades.

The Growing Role of Communication
Two main concerns in Control System involves determinism and achieving quality of control:

The Determinism is based on a Deadline and Probability of satisfying deadline:


Latency and Quality of Control considering Latencies Ƭca (Control to Actuator), ƬZOH (A to D conversion).



Quality of Control is reliant on Reliable communication!

Emerging Scenario in Industrial Automation
Electric Power Systems are considered part of Critical Infrastructure. The automation of power systems is mission critical. Modernization of these systems involve Integrated communication. communication & data exchange layers:
Execution to Co-ordination Layer
Between Devices in Co-ordination Layer
Co-ordination to Management Layer
Management to Remote Management Layer
